shiny kitchen treasure. Op-Shop Show-Off March 5th, 2013




i was pleased as punch when Terry turned up with this WMF lemon juicer this week ($2). we had a cheap plastic supermarket one that had driven me mad falling over or apart mid juicing for months whilst i waited in hope of scoring an old school heavy glass one. great timing for tabbouleh making with the cherry tomatoes  cucumbers, parsley and mint from our garden. hopefully next year we will use our own lemons too since the TLC we have lavished on our sorry sapling this year appear to be bringing it back from the brink of death by leaf curl and malnutrition.
